I try to follow guide from 1. Generate TLS certificate for Microsoft Entra ID to do authentication | FortiNAC-F 7.6.5 | Fortinet Document Library to generate EAP-TLS from intune.

In Method 2 Step 2 why i got error when Subject Name Format i fill to CN={{UserPrincipleName}} and the other attribut also have same error.

Also whay i must fill in certification authority and certification authority name?

Screenshot 2026-03-16 091747.png

 

Best answer by funkylicious

its not CN={{UserPrincipleName}} but CN={{UserPrincipalName}} .

as for the CA, i guess you need a valid and trusted CA on the computers which signs it and then gets validated.
